The Hilton Glasgow Grosvenor is a 4 star hotel located less than 10 minute walk to the Botanical Garden, Oran Mor and other local attractions in the west end of Glasgow, It is 5 minutes from the M8 motorway, 20 minutes from the airport and 2 minute walk from the Hillhead Subway Station. The Hilton offers ensuite rooms and suites complete with hairdryer, safe, radio, T.V., telephone, trouser press, central heating, Internet access, computer games and fax. Onsite Bo’vine Restaurant serves traditional Scottish food. The Bobar welcomes guests with a range of wines, cocktails, beers, spirits and light meals. Guests can also relax in front of the inviting fireplace on the Terrace Lounge, which serves drinks and snacks. The Hilton offers complimentary usage of the Livingwell Health Club located at the Hilton Glasgow Hotel which is 3 miles away. The hotel also has 6 conference rooms equipped for conferences, seminars, weddings and other special events. The hotel provides 24 room service, concierge, express check in / checkout, laundry, porters, room service, car park and child care.

Facilities & Amenities
The hotel provides a range of facilities, though guest experiences are varied. Many appreciate the spacious rooms and the availability of tea and coffee facilities, along with an iron and ironing board, contributing to a comfortable stay. However, a significant number of guests report that the lifts are frequently out of service, causing considerable inconvenience, especially for those with mobility challenges or heavy luggage. The absence of air conditioning is a common complaint, particularly during warmer periods, often leading guests to rely on provided fans or open windows. Furthermore, many rooms lack a refrigerator, which some find inconvenient. While the hotel features a bar and restaurant, some guests note the absence of a dedicated gym or a separate residents' lounge beyond the main bar area. The TVs in rooms are sometimes criticized for poor signal or limited channel selection.
Cleanliness & Room Comfort
Guest feedback on room comfort and cleanliness is notably mixed. Many commend the comfortable beds and clean towels, often describing rooms as spacious and well-maintained. However, a substantial number of reviews highlight issues with the overall condition and cleanliness. Common complaints include dated decor, stains on headboards and carpets, mould in bathrooms or on walls, and cracked sinks. Some guests report finding dust, cobwebs, or even dirty items left from previous occupants. Noise is a significant concern, with many experiencing disturbances from street traffic due to single-glazed windows, service lifts, loud events held within the hotel, and even clanging heating pipes or other guests' slamming doors. Room heating can also be problematic, with radiators sometimes obstructed by curtains, leading to cold rooms or cold bathrooms.

Location & Accessibility
The hotel's central location is overwhelmingly praised as excellent, perfect, and convenient, making it a significant draw for guests. It is ideally situated directly opposite the beautiful Botanic Gardens and within easy walking distance of Byres Road, offering a vibrant selection of shops, cafes, and restaurants. Key attractions like Ashton Lane, the University, and concert venues such as Oran Mor are also very close by. Access to public transport is convenient, with a subway station and bus stops nearby, facilitating travel throughout the city. However, parking is a major point of contention. Guests frequently report very limited on-site spaces, often shared with a nearby supermarket, leading to difficulties, inconvenience, and sometimes additional costs. Street parking is also restricted and often requires app-based payment.

Additional Information
Several important details emerge from guest feedback that do not fit into other categories. The hotel is a historic Victorian building that was formerly part of a well-known hotel chain, with many guests comparing its current state to its past. A significant and recurring issue is that the guest lifts are frequently out of service for extended periods, forcing guests to use stairs, which is particularly challenging for those with mobility issues. The hotel operates a pet-friendly policy, though dogs are generally not permitted in the main restaurant or bar areas, and cannot be left unattended in rooms, which can limit dining options for pet owners. Guests should also be aware of potential noise from events or parties held within the hotel, especially during weekends, which can disturb sleep. There have also been reports of unexpected water shut-offs for maintenance and confusion regarding check-out times.
